Good luck to Tymoteusz Witek, who is exhibiting at this years Stripe Young Scientist and Technology Exhibiton.

Tymoteusz has had a keen interest in human biology for a long time now and is also a frequent gym go-er! He was interested in finding a way to use his knowledge of human biology to aid his weightlifting performance. In his research, Tymoteusz has been examining the effect of cooling the muscles and the palms of the hands between sets. Tymoteusz is examining whether the cooling of the muscles increases the amount of reps a person could do compared to an ordinary session! The main contributor to fatigue on the last rep is the overheating of the muscle. This is due to an enzyme in the energy-producing machinery (mitochondria) in the muscle cells that turns off if it experiences too much heat. Without this energy, the muscle fails to do any more reps. Tymoteusz is continuing to test his theory with TY students to see if ice packs can combat this overheating and improve their gym performance.
